CHARLES R. JONES, Judge.

The Appellants, Raymond Hart and Louisiana Workers' Compensation Corporation, appeal the judgment of the Worker's Compensation Court finding Mr. Hart was arbitrary and capricious in erroneously calculating the weekly wages of Fred C. Troutman, thus assessing Mr. Hart with penalties and attorney fees. We affirm.
